What Deportation Means and Why It Happens
Deportation, formally known as removal, is the legal process through which the United States federal government orders a non-citizen to leave the country. There are numerous causes why removal proceedings might be begun. Usual reasons consist of visa overstays, criminal convictions, unauthorized entry into the United States, fraud or misrepresentation on immigration documentation, and violations of the requirements of a visa or green card. Key Steps in the Deportation Defense Process
The deportation defense process generally entails a sequence of systematic steps. First, the person receives a Notice to Appear, which describes the government’s claims and the statutory basis for pursuing removal. After the NTA is filed with the immigration tribunal, a initial calendar hearing is set. This first hearing is similar to an arraignment in criminal court, where the respondent responds to the allegations, and the judge establishes upcoming hearing dates. During this hearing, the respondent can declare whether they will be seeking any kind of relief from removal.
Following the master calendar hearing, the procedure ordinarily advances to an individual merits hearing. This is the step where the respondent offers supporting documentation, summons witnesses, and advances legal claims in furtherance of their case. The government, represented by an ICE trial attorney, likewise puts forward its position for removal. The immigration judge then examines the testimony and legal contentions before issuing a judgment. If the judge orders removal, the respondent has the right to appeal the judgment to the Board of Immigration Appeals (BIA), and in particular cases, to federal circuit courts.
Common Forms of Relief from Deportation
One of the most vital components of a deportation defense strategy is identifying the proper type of relief. Numerous lawful pathways might be available contingent upon the individual’s situation. Cancellation of deportation is one such pathway, accessible to both legal permanent residents and particular non-permanent category of individuals who satisfy defined qualifying criteria, including continuous bodily residency in the United States and proof of remarkable and exceptionally unusual difficulty to qualifying family relatives.
Asylum is another form of relief accessible to individuals who have suffered oppression or have a reasonable fear of oppression in their home country because of race, faith, national origin, political stance, or affiliation with a distinct social group. Withholding of deportation and relief under the Convention Against Torture are connected types of legal protection with elevated evidentiary standards but afford shelter from expulsion to a given country.
Adjustment of status, voluntary departure, and prosecutorial discretion are supplementary avenues that could apply in certain cases. Each form of relief has its particular set of conditions, and establishing suitability calls for a careful examination of the individual’s immigration record, criminal background, familial relationships, and further important factors.
